| | Quake 4 problem Hi I recently installed windows vista home premium on my pc. When trying to install quake 4 it tells me that there are known compatibility issues with vista. Any advice on a possible solution or on an available patch would be greatly appreciated. Thank you |

| | Re: Quake 4 problem "Tom" <Tom@discussions.microsoft.com> wrote in message news:A6D3E57F-B6BE-4B7B-8302-0C343BDC6DC2@microsoft.com... > Hi > I recently installed windows vista home premium on my pc. When trying to > install quake 4 it tells me that there are known compatibility issues with > vista. Any advice on a possible solution or on an available patch would be > greatly appreciated. > > Thank you > This is how I got Quake4 to install. Close the autorun prompt when you insert the disk. Browse to the CD and look for the setup.exe file. With pointer over the setup.exe file right click and then left click Run as Administrator. Then it should give you the warning of incompatibility. Click Run Program. You should be able to install Quake4. Also make sure you have the latest version of Flash player. |
